Gujarat civic polls: BJP sweeps all six municipal corporations

The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) swept all six municipal corporations in Gujarat on Tuesday (February 23, 2021). The ruling party won 483 out of the total 576 seats. It retained power in all the six municipal corporations in the state -- Ahmedabad, Surat, Vadodara, Rajkot, Jamnagar and Bhavnagar.
